Abstract:
The current climate observing system cannot address the range of important scientific and societally important climate issues. A significantly expanded climate observing system could address major science questions and meet important societal needs. Careful independent testing can evaluate whether proposed systems can address critical observing needs. Future investments in climate observations offer large societal benefits and economic return on investments.
